Issue with Integrating iFrame Components in PowerApps

Hello everyone,

 

I am facing an issue with integrating iFrame components into my PowerApps application. I have followed two tutorials, one by Reza and another by April, which use different methods but achieve the same result. Unfortunately, I can't replicate certain actions shown in the tutorials.

1- Issue with Reza's tutorial (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=JxPznTUsaiQ 😞

  • At one point, Reza clicks on "Get More Components". However, this option does not appear in my PowerApps interface, preventing me from proceeding. Here is a screenshot showing the absence of "Get More Components" in my PowerApp:

tuto Resa.png2- Issue with April's tutorial (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=reWFYrON_rE ) :

  • April clicks on "Component", then "New Component". In the window that opens, there are two tabs: "Canvas" and "Code". She clicks on the "Code" tab to choose the file downloaded from the Github in "yashag2255/iframePCF" account. However, this "Code" tab does not appear in my PowerApps. Here is a screenshot showing the absence of the "Code" tab in my PowerApp.

Appril.png

I am wondering if this is due to a version difference in PowerApps, as April's video is from 2020-12-08 and Reza's video is from  2023-07-10, or if it might be a licensing issue. In both cases, certain options are not available in my PowerApps.

I would greatly appreciate your help in importing this iFrame component, as it is crucial for my project. If anyone can provide a recent tutorial or send me the iFrame component in the .msapp format, it would be immensely helpful. I have verified that I can import .msapp files without any issues.

My active powerApps version is 3.24054.19

    Hi @DILIGENCE ,

     

    1\At one point, Reza clicks on "Get More Components". However, this option does not appear in my PowerApps interface, preventing me from proceeding. Here is a screenshot showing the absence of "Get More Components" in my PowerApp.

     

    The position of this button has been adjusted to the top.

    vbofengmsft_1-1718328471465.png

     

    2\April clicks on "Component", then "New Component". In the window that opens, there are two tabs: "Canvas" and "Code". She clicks on the "Code" tab to choose the file downloaded from the Github in "yashag2255/iframePCF" account. However, this "Code" tab does not appear in my PowerApps. Here is a screenshot showing the absence of the "Code" tab in my PowerApp.

     

    Please turn on this feature for your environment in admin center.

    vbofengmsft_2-1718328818719.png

    Hello @v-bofeng-msft,

     

    Thank you so much for your prompt and helpful response. Activating the "PowerApp Components Framework" feature in my environment resolved the issue completely.
